“…Nitrogen dioxide is a toxic gas to organisms, and one of the main factors in forming acid rain, which is mainly discharged into the atmosphere through the burning process of substances [1,2] . As a gas detection technology, photoacoustic spectroscopy has the advantages of high sensitivity, fast response, and good selectivity [3][4][5][6][7] , and is widely used in the fields of atmospheric monitoring, medical diagnosis, combustion analysis, and electric power detection [8][9][10][11][12] . Recently, some scholars have developed NO2 photoacoustic detection setups [13][14][15][16][17] .…”
